XHTML

Was ist XHTML?
XHTML ist eine strikt definierte Auszeichnungssprache für Webseiten, die HTML mit den strengeren Regeln von XML kombiniert. Ziel ist sauberes, wohlgeformtes Markup, das von Browsern, Tools und automatisierten Systemen zuverlässig gelesen, geprüft und weiterverarbeitet werden kann.
XHTML spielt überall dort eine Rolle, wo strukturierte, valide und maschinenlesbare HTML-Inhalte benötigt werden – zum Beispiel in professionellen E-Commerce-Setups mit Shopware, Shopify Plus oder Magento, in denen Produktseiten automatisiert generiert, geprüft und aus Systemen wie PIM oder ERP ausgespielt werden.
1. Grundlagen: Was bedeutet XHTML genau?
XHTML steht für Extensible HyperText Markup Language. Es ist eine Familie von Auszeichnungssprachen, die HTML-Semantik mit der strengen Syntax von XML verbindet. Technisch gesehen ist XHTML eine XML-Anwendung, die Elemente und Attribute aus HTML neu definiert.
Im Unterschied zu klassischem HTML fordert XHTML, dass jedes Dokument wohlgeformt ist. Das bedeutet unter anderem:
Diese Regeln machen XHTML für Parser, Validatoren und automatisierte Content-Pipelines besonders gut nutzbar, weil Fehler früh erkannt werden und Daten zuverlässiger weiterverarbeitet werden können.
2. Die wichtigsten Merkmale von XHTML
XHTML bringt eine Reihe von Eigenschaften mit, die sich direkt auf Qualität, Wartbarkeit und Automatisierung von Webinhalten auswirken.
Für E-Commerce-Teams sind diese Merkmale deshalb wichtig, weil Produktseiten und Kategorieseiten häufig aus unterschiedlichen Systemen zusammengebaut werden und strenge, berechenbare Strukturen für Automatisierung und Skalierung unerlässlich sind.
3. XHTML im Vergleich zu HTML und HTML5
Um XHTML sinnvoll einzuordnen, hilft der direkte Vergleich mit HTML und HTML5.
| Aspekt | XHTML | HTML / HTML5 |
|---|---|---|
| Syntax | Strenge XML-Regeln, wohlgeformt | Toleranter, Browser korrigieren Fehler |
| Fehlerbehandlung | Parsing bricht bei Fehlern ab | Browser versuchen, Fehler auszugleichen |
| Kompatibilität | Ideal für XML-Tools und Parser | Standard für moderne Webentwicklung |
| Empfehlung heute | Spezialfälle, strenge XML-Umgebungen | HTML5 als De-facto-Standard |
In aktuellen Webprojekten dominiert HTML5. Viele XHTML-Regeln – wie saubere Verschachtelung, geschlossene Tags und Anführungszeichen bei Attributen – gelten aber weiterhin als Best Practices. Wer heute „sauberes HTML“ schreibt, orientiert sich praktisch an den XHTML-Konventionen, auch wenn das Dokument formal HTML5 ist.
4. Wichtige XHTML-Varianten und Doctypes
Unter dem Begriff XHTML werden mehrere Spezifikationen der W3C geführt. In der Praxis begegnen dir vor allem:
Die Erkennung eines XHTML-Dokuments erfolgt über den Doctype und die Namespace-Deklaration. Ein typischer Doctype für XHTML 1.0 Transitional sieht so aus: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
...
</html>
Für SEO, Crawlbarkeit und Indexierung durch Suchmaschinen wie Google spielt der konkrete XHTML-Doctype heute eine geringere Rolle als früher. Entscheidend ist, dass der Code konsistent, schnell ladend und mobile-optimiert ist.
5. XHTML-Syntaxregeln im Detail
Die Kernidee von XHTML ist, HTML in ein wohlgeformtes XML-Korsett zu packen. Daraus ergeben sich konkrete Anforderungen:
Wer automatisiert Content generiert, sollte diese Regeln auch bei HTML5 berücksichtigen, um sauberen, stabilen Quelltext zu erzeugen, der beim Import in Shop-Systeme oder Templates keine unerwarteten Fehler verursacht.
6. XHTML im E-Commerce-Kontext
Im E-Commerce ist XHTML vor allem über seine Prinzipien relevant: strukturierte, wohldefinierte und valide Produktseiten. Ob du formal XHTML oder HTML5 verwendest, ist weniger wichtig als die Konsequenz, mit der du gültigen Code erzeugst.
Typische Anwendungsfelder, in denen XHTML-Regeln helfen, sind:
Tools wie feed2content.ai® arbeiten feed-basiert und erzeugen strukturierten HTML-Content in großem Umfang. Werden XHTML-Prinzipien beachtet, steigt die Wahrscheinlichkeit, dass diese Inhalte in Shopware, Magento, Shopify Plus und anderen Systemen ohne manuelle Nacharbeit sauber gerendert werden.
7. Vorteile und Grenzen von XHTML für moderne Websites
Auch wenn HTML5 heute Standard ist, lohnt sich der Blick auf die Vor- und Nachteile von XHTML bzw. XHTML-ähnlichen Kodierregeln.
Die pragmatische Lösung in vielen E-Commerce-Projekten ist ein HTML5-Doctype mit konsequenter Anwendung der XHTML-Regeln für saubere Syntax. So profitierst du von der Flexibilität von HTML5 und der Stabilität von wohlgeformtem Markup.
8. Best Practices: Sauberes Markup für Produktseiten
Ob du XHTML oder HTML5 nutzt – für SEO, Conversion-Rate und technische Stabilität zählt sauberer Quelltext. Einige praxiserprobte Empfehlungen:
In automatisierten Setups, in denen tausende Produkttexte aus Feeds generiert werden, sollte die Qualität des HTML-Ausgabeschemas mindestens einmal gründlich geprüft werden. Danach laufen selbst große Bulk-Produktionen stabil.
8.1 XHTML, SEO und technische Qualität
Für Google und andere Suchmaschinen zählt weniger, ob explizit XHTML als Doctype verwendet wird, sondern ob die Seite schnell, mobilfähig, nutzerfreundlich und technisch sauber ist. Sauberes, wohldefiniertes Markup trägt dazu bei:
Besonders bei großen Katalogen mit tausenden URLs ist es sinnvoll, HTML- oder XHTML-Fehler systematisch zu minimieren, um technische SEO-Risiken zu reduzieren.
8.2 Technische Qualität mit SEO-Checkern prüfen
Wenn du sicherstellen möchtest, dass dein XHTML- oder HTML-Markup für Suchmaschinen sauber ausgeliefert wird, hilft ein regelmäßiger OnPage-Check inklusive technischer Analyse und Crawling-Simulation.
9. Technische Umsetzung: Von XML-Feed zu (X)HTML
Viele Onlineshops nutzen Produktfeeds im XML-Format als Grundlage für Content-Automatisierung. Die Übersetzung von Feed-Attributen in (X)HTML-Strukturen erfolgt typischerweise über Templates oder regelbasierte Ansätze.
Je strikter du dich in diesem Prozess an XHTML-Regeln orientierst, desto einfacher ist die Qualitätssicherung mit automatischen Tests, Validierungstools und visuellen Checks im Frontend.
10. Häufige Fehler und typische Stolpersteine bei XHTML
In der Praxis treten immer wieder ähnliche Probleme auf, wenn Content automatisiert als XHTML oder HTML ausgegeben wird:
Diese Fehler lassen sich durch strenge Templates, Validierungsroutinen und klar dokumentierte Content-Richtlinien vermeiden. Gerade im Bulk-Betrieb profitierst du davon, wenn diese Regeln einmal sauber definiert und anschließend konsequent umgesetzt werden.
11. Häufige Fragen zu XHTML
Wofür wird XHTML heute noch verwendet?
XHTML wird heute vor allem dort eingesetzt, wo strikt wohlgeformtes Markup benötigt wird, zum Beispiel in Systemen, die XML Parser oder XSLT Transformationen verwenden, in spezialisierten Webanwendungen mit hohen Anforderungen an Validität oder in Legacy-Projekten, die historisch auf XHTML 1.0 oder XHTML 1.1 basieren und weiterhin gepflegt werden.
Was ist der Unterschied zwischen HTML und XHTML?
Der zentrale Unterschied liegt in der Syntax: XHTML folgt den strengen Regeln von XML und verlangt wohlgeformte Dokumente mit geschlossenen und korrekt verschachtelten Tags, während HTML und HTML5 toleranter sind und von Browsern häufig automatisch korrigiert werden, was Fehler im Markup eher kaschiert als verhindert.
Ist XHTML noch zeitgemäß?
XHTML als eigenständiger Dokumenttyp ist weniger verbreitet als früher, aber viele seiner Regeln gelten weiterhin als Best Practice, sodass moderne HTML5 Projekte oft faktisch XHTML ähnliche Konventionen verwenden, auch wenn der offizielle Doctype ein HTML5 Doctype ist und nicht explizit auf XHTML verweist.
Welchen Einfluss hat XHTML auf SEO?
XHTML selbst ist kein direkter Rankingfaktor, aber sauberes und validierbares Markup erleichtert das Crawling, reduziert Darstellungsfehler und verbessert die technische Qualität der Seite, was indirekt positive Effekte auf SEO haben kann, insbesondere in großen E Commerce Projekten mit vielen indexierten URLs.
Sollte ich neue Projekte mit XHTML oder HTML5 starten?
Für neue Webprojekte ist HTML5 der etablierte Standard, während die strengen XHTML Prinzipien als Orientierung für sauberes Markup dienen sollten, sodass du zwar formal HTML5 verwendest, deine Templates aber in Syntax und Struktur an die strengen Regeln angelehnt sind, um Stabilität und Wartbarkeit zu erhöhen.
Wie kann ich prüfen, ob mein XHTML valides Markup ist?
Du kannst XHTML beziehungsweise HTML Code mit W3C Validatoren, integrierten IDE Tools oder automatisierten Test Pipelines prüfen, indem du Beispielseiten durchlaufen lässt, auf Fehlermeldungen achtest und Markup Richtlinien in deinem Team etablierst, sodass neue Templates und Inhalte regelmäßig gegen diese Regeln getestet werden.
Welche Rolle spielt XHTML bei automatisierter Content-Erstellung?
Bei automatisierter Content Erstellung aus Produktfeeds hilft XHTML durch seine klar definierten Syntaxregeln, weil generierter Text in stabile HTML Strukturen eingebettet wird, die sich leichter validieren, überwachen und in Shop Systeme exportieren lassen, was insbesondere bei tausenden Produktseiten manuelle Fehlerquellen deutlich reduziert.
12. Nächste Schritte: Sauberen (X)HTML-Content skalieren
Wenn du Produkttexte, Kategorieseiten oder Landingpages in großem Umfang erzeugen möchtest, profitierst du von einem klaren Template-Ansatz mit sauberem, XHTML-nahem Markup. So stellst du sicher, dass dein Content nicht nur gut klingt, sondern technisch stabil ist und sich problemlos in Shop-Systeme, PIM oder ERP integrieren lässt.
Du möchtest sehen, wie sich deine Produktdaten in saubere, SEO-fähige (X)HTML-Strukturen verwandeln lassen, die direkt shopfertig sind?
Kostenlos startenDu hast noch Fragen?








Keine Kommentare vorhanden